How TerraCycle Combines Corporate Responsibility and Profits
05/12/2017 Duración: 12minTom Szaky shares how TerraCycle got started, how it continues to grow, and future plans for the company. He uses a three-question model to determine how to take materials that were typically considered unrecyclable, collect and reuse the materials in over 20 countries. The company deals with two to four million pounds of garbage weekly, and future plans include collecting containers, cleaning and refilling them. They partner with organizations to create programs that recycle these materials, giving companies an edge over the competition.
